Reed, Portland, OR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Reed?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
Reed Studio Apartments | $1,371 | $875 | $2,250 |
| Reed 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,740 | $1,000 | $3,096 |
| Reed 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,452 | $1,290 | $7,180 |
| Reed 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,450 | $1,845 | $7,124 |
| Reed 4 Bedroom Apartments | $13,185 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Studio Reed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Reed with Studio?
Currently the most affordable Studio in Reed is at Tabor Commons listed at $995.
How much is the average rent for a Studio Reed Apartment?
The average rent for a Studio Apartment in Reed is $1,371.
What is the largest available Studio Reed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Reed is a 1,500 square feet unit starting from $1,438 at Z_Caritas Sacred Heart Villa.
What is the average size for Reed Studio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Studio rental in Reed is currently 460 sq ft.
